Learn to refasten loose plaster, tape and mud cracks, and mix plaster repair materials for historic buildings. Paul Hayden of Indiana Landmarks brings his four decades of experience in the field to lead attendees in hands-on demonstrations of plaster wall repair and patching at South Bend’s historic Kizer House. No prior knowledge or experience required.Participants can choose between two workshop times: October 2 at Noon or October 2 at 6 p.m. The workshop lasts approximately 1.5 to 2 hours and will take place at 803 W. Washington St. in South Bend’s West Washington Historic District. Questions? Contact [email protected].
Note: Due to the workshop location, the event is not accessible to all. Attendees should wear gloves, closed-toed shoes, and clothes that can get dirty.
This event is one in a series of trades training workshops presented by Indiana Landmarks and South Bend TradeWorks aimed at equipping historic homeowners with DIY knowledge and contractors with in-demand skills to offer clients with historic building repair needs.
